Specification:

 

  1. Grain Length: Long-grain variety, typically ranging from 7.5 to 8.3 mm.
  2. Color: The grains have a golden hue, which is a result of the parboiling process.
  3. Texture: It has a fluffy texture when cooked, with each grain remaining separate.
  4. Aroma: Known for its characteristic Basmati aroma, which is sweet and nutty.
  5. Cooking Quality: It cooks well and is suitable for various rice dishes, especially biryanis and pilafs.
  6. Origin: Named after the Pusa Institute in India, where it was developed to enhance yield and quality.
  7. Parboiling Process: The rice undergoes a parboiling process before milling, which helps retain nutrients in the grain and gives it the golden color.
